About The Position

As an Epic Analyst at Epic Systems, you will serve as the primary support contact for specific Epic applications, playing a crucial role in the organization's operational health and project success. This position involves a mix of operational experience, project management, and organizational skills, ensuring that project teams remain focused and that the Epic system aligns with the organization's business needs. This position is interim and cannot be extended more than 6 months past the Analyst’s hire date. If the Epic Analyst is unable to successfully obtain the required Epic certification(s) to qualify them to move into a Certified Epic Analyst role, they may not remain in this role. If an applicable role is available in which they are qualified, they may transfer into that role.

Requirements

  • Clinical operations experience
  • Epic end-user or application support experience
  • Experience supporting clinical applications or healthcare environments.
  • Epic certification is preferred upon hire but may be obtained within 6 months of hire.

Responsibilities

  • Act as the main support contact for the application's end-users, addressing and resolving any issues that arise.
  • Collaborate with various teams to identify and resolve issues impacting application performance and user experience.
  • Guide workflow design, system build, and testing, and tackle technical challenges associated with Epic software.
  • Manage system changes as per user requests and organizational needs.
  • Function as a liaison between end-users, Epic implementation staff, and business stakeholders to ensure system functionality meets business requirements.
  • Maintain regular communication with Epic representatives and participate in weekly project team meetings.
  • Engage with the business community and end-users to understand operational needs and direct workflow configurations.
  • Lead training initiatives and support end-users with troubleshooting and problem-solving.
  • Consistently review project status and issues with leadership, ensuring project deliverables and timelines are met.
  • Conduct weekly team meetings to discuss project deliverables, shared issues, user concerns, budget, and milestones.
